Caring

Regulations met

9 September 2025

We found this practice was providing caring services in accordance with the relevant regulations and had taken into consideration appropriate guidance.

Kindness, compassion and dignity

Regulations met

Patient feedback provided a positive view of the dental team and care provided by the practice. One patient told us, “Happy with the dental care I have received over the years.” We were also told, “Only dentist I use in Birmingham, from the receptionist to doctors always provide the best service.”

Patient comments included that staff were welcoming and attentive, acted with integrity, and showed compassion.

Patients said staff were professional, courteous, and considerate.

Patients felt they were treated as individuals, and their personal and cultural needs were respected.

We were provided with a patient survey. This provided a positive view of the service with 22 of the 25 respondents rating their overall experience as excellent. The results of the 2024 patient survey were on display in the waiting room. We saw that where suggestions had been made by patients such as adding a television on the ceiling in the hygienist room, this had been implemented.

People received care from staff who were aware of their responsibility to respect people’s diversity and human rights, and of the importance of privacy and confidentiality. We observed positive interactions between staff and patients both in person and on the telephone. The receptionist was heard offering various appointment times to accommodate patient wishes. Staff treated patients with kindness, respect and compassion. Staff displayed an understanding of patients’ needs and were attentive and kind when dealing with patients.

Staff felt respected, valued and supported in their roles, and their wellbeing was supported.
